Solesino, Veneto, Italy

Overview

Set in Veneto's countryside, Solesino is a charming small town offering an authentic Italian experience away from tourist crowds. It features historical piazzas, local markets, and friendly residents, perfectly suited for a peaceful getaway.

Best Time to Visit

April-June and September-October for mild weather and fewer crowds.

Local Tips

Shops may close midday for 'pausa pranzo' (lunch break); remember to greet shopkeepers and locals with 'Buongiorno.' Public transit is limited, renting a car is recommended to explore the area.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is appreciated but not obligatory (round up at restaurants). Dress modestly when visiting churches. Greeting with a handshake or light cheek kiss is common.

Safety Warnings

Solesino is very safe, but always secure valuables and be cautious of pickpockets near markets or on busy festival days. No major areas to avoid.

Hidden Gems

Explore the scenic Parco del Roncajette, visit the local Wednesday and Saturday markets, and enjoy traditional gelato at family-run bars.
